Raymond J. Murphy | Lower Merion officer, 69

Raymond J. "Murph" Murphy, 69, of Bryn Mawr, a Lower Merion police officer for 28 years, died of complications from lung cancer Tuesday at Bryn Mawr Hospital.

Mr. Murphy graduated from Lower Merion High School, where he was a standout basketball player. He then served in the Army in Texas.

After his discharge, he was an emergency medical technician for the Narberth Ambulance Corps and also volunteered with the Narberth Fire Company. In 1963, he joined the Lower Merion Township Police Department. He retired in 1991. Everyone in the township knew him, his daughter Julia said. He was outgoing and was always offering help - whether it was a ride or other assistance - to his neighbors, she said.

Mr. Murphy enjoyed daily gym workouts and riding his bike along the river drives in Philadelphia.

He and his wife, Susan Shapiro Murphy, had two children before separating in 1978. She died in January.

In addition to his daughter, Mr. Murphy is survived by another daughter, Stephanie; a brother; and his longtime companion, Kathleen C. Monahan.
